1 CoursesCertificate in plumbing techniques in Georgian college
On Campus
Students are provided with the theoretical and practical training to perform most basic plumbing techniques. Students will be exposed to topics including health and safety, reading of drawings, applied math, communications, plumbing code, plumbing theory, practical application and installation practices.
OSSD or equivalent with Grade 12 English (C or U), Secondary or high school transcripts with proof of graduation, subjects taken, and grades received, Math and English credits are required at the Grade 12 level, Test scores: TOEFL iBT of 79, IELTS of 6.0, CAEL of 60.
At the completion of the program, students are ready to apply for work as a Plumber's helper or apprentice, or work in related fields. Graduates pursuing an apprenticeship may find a range of occupations in the plumbing field, including construction, maintenance, industrial as well as service related opportunities such as wholesale and retail and municipal waterworks.
